The landscape of affordable vehicles in the U.S. has changed significantly, with a mere 28 cars currently priced below $30,000.
This reduction in options prompts a closer look at which automakers are still prioritizing budget-conscious consumers.
As the number of affordable cars dwindles, potential buyers may find themselves facing limited choices in the market.
